Description

Hours:
Friday, September 17: 5:00 to 10:00 p.m. (no arts & crafts booths)
Saturday, September 18: 9:00 a.m. to 7:00 p.m.
Sunday, September 19: 10: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.

Location: Kirkwood Park, 111 S. Geyer Rd. Map It. A festival map is under development and will be posted here later. Dogs are NOT allowed at the Greentree Festival unless they are participating in the Dog Show or Frisbee Contest on Friday night.

Greentree Parade: The parade steps off at 10:00 a.m., Saturday morning, September 18. The parade begins at Kirkwood High School, goes east on Essex to Kirkwood Rd., south on Kirkwood Rd. to Argonne, west on Argonne, ending at the Kirkwood Community Center.

Vendor Booths:   Arts & Crafts booths and Food/Game/Information Booths fill out the long list of fun activities every year at the Greentree Festival in Kirkwood Park. (No Arts & Crafts booths Friday night.)

Shuttle Service: All Three Days The Greentree Festival Shuttle will run continuously on:

  • Friday night from 6:00 to 10:00 p.m.
  • Saturday and Sunday from 10:00 a.m. to the close of the festival both days.

The Greentree shuttle is FREE and accessible to those with disabilities. To use the wheelchair-accessible shuttle, the wheelchair must be certified for mobile transportation. To access the shuttle: Park at St. Louis Community College at Meramec, in Lots R and S, on the northeast corner of the campus, easily accessible from Geyer Road and Rose Hill Avenue. Look for the yellow school bus. It will take you to the dropoff and pick-up point on Amphitheatre Drive near the water tower in the park. Thanks to the Shuttle Sponsor: SSMHealth St. Clare Hospital
